  1. Hello, I freshly installed Prestashop 1.7.4.4. on my server. On my server Prestashop 1.7.2.4. works fine, I can just install it via the interface of the hoster. The update to Prestashop 1.7.4.4. with the 1-click modul didnt work. Neither with the version from the marketplace, nor with the beta version from github. So, I deleted this installation and tried to install PS 1.7.4.4. The installation process just finishes normal. But when I try to access the frontpage, there are many images missing (see screenshot). Also if I replace an image with another image, it still doesnt work. When I try to access the BO, I just get the internal server error. Nothing more. Activating the debug mode via FTP was not working. I set it in the defines.inc.php file but I got the same Internal Server Error. So, after digging into this problem and searching through this great board for a solution, I found out, that there might be a problem with the .htaccess file of the admin folder: https://www.prestashop.com/forums/topic/909265-error-500-while-installing-1743/?do=findComment&comment=2994820 So I just marked the section as a comment: # <IfModule mod_negotiation.c> # #Options -MultiViews # </IfModule> I also thought that the problem with the images might be the same, but in this .htaccess file there was no such lines. So I just deactivated the .htaccess file by renaming it to backup.htaccess. Now everything works. BUT: I just think that there might be a huge security problem. Could somebody help me and tell me, how else I could solve my problem and what the reason is? I am quite lost to be honest and I need to get this shop running. Kind regards, maheu
